Scientific Data Management (SDM) refers to storage and retrieval of
scientific data from various storage sources such as main memory, disk
and tape. SDM covers integration of data formats; data description,
organization and metadata management; efficient indexing and querying; and
file transfer as well as remote access and distributed data management
across networks.

Data analysis techniques include simple post-processing
(e.g., aggregating data) of experimental data
or simulation output, as well as the use of mathematical
methods (e.g., filtering data) and statistical tests.
Data mining usually refers to the application of more advanced mathematical
techniques such as classification, clustering, pattern recognition,
etc.

Visualization of data is an invaluable tool for getting a feel for how
simulation output may vary in time or with changes in parameter
values, or for the locations of interesting regions in large data sets.
The term visualization often is used to describe the rendering of
3D isosurfaces and volumes, whereas the term graphics usually is
applied to plots such as scatter plots and histograms.
Several visualization tools supported by NERSC also provide interactive
manipulation of the display of data in order to facilitate data exploration.

Workflow management refers to the process of connecting various
software tools based on specific input and output parameters. The goal
of workflow management is to automatize specific sets of tasks that
are repeated many times and thus simplify execution and avoid
typical human errors that often occur when repetitive tasks are performed.
Highly interactive data exploration is a key component of scientific
analytics, often combining multiple analytics technologies, such as
data mining and visualization, to find important features within data
or to discover the essential results from a simulation or experiment.
A relatively new term, discourse, refers not only to the
integration of analytics technologies, but also to the goal - knowledge
discovery - and to the interactive nature of the process of reaching that goal.
